"Posting Through It" is a political news podcast exploring the intersection of modern politics and social media through independent reporting, analysis, and commentary. It is hosted by acclaimed investigative journalists Jared Holt and Michael Edison Hayden and regularly features in-depth interviews with guests.

65: The Sued Stormer (7/22/19) ft/ Luke O'Brien
On Episode 65 of sh!tpost, Jared Holt walks through news updates on the president’s racist tweets, Proud Boys, QAnon, and the smear that Rep. Ilhan Omar secretly married her brother. We’re joined by HuffPost reporter Luke O’Brien for a debrief on the state of neo-Nazi blogger Andrew Anglin and his website The Daily Stormer, which were recently ruled against in court to the tune of $18,000,000 in damages to two plaintiffs. Bonus Interview for Subscribers
In this bonus interview, which paid subscribers to SH!TPOST get an exclusive first listen to, I speak with Caleb Cain—a young man radicalized and then de-radicalized on YouTube—about one of the questions I get most often. If you meet someone who has been radicalized online, how do you reach out to them?I include the caveat that the responsibility of de-radicalization is not one that every person should take upon themselves; depending on the individuals involved, it can sometimes put folks in harm’s way. But for those up to the task, Caleb shares some tips on talking to people who are in a spot he found himself when he was at his most extreme. This is a public episode.
